PATHOGENETIC TREATMENT OF ARTERIAL HYPERTENSION: THE PLACE OF CALCIUM ANTAGONISTS
The paper describes the key aspects of arterial hypertension pathogenesis and the relevant therapeutic strategies. The authors discuss the role of increased peripheral vascular resistance and hypervolemia as factors which can be targeted by calcium channel blockers. The new evidence on this medicati...
